Swindon Music Service
The Charity aims to create opportunities which will deepen the interests and skills of children and youngpeople from 0 to 18, and families and people of all ages in the community through providing a range ofmusical and social experiences. Music programmes in local schools will be delivered, supported and facilitated.

Annual Returns
As filed with the Charity Commission for England and Wales. Most recent filing covers the financial year ending 2025.
| Financial Year | Income | Expenditure | Charitable Spending | Net Assets | Reserves | Staff |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| £834,476 | £666,046 | £663,307 | £350,190 | £350,190 | 32 / 4 |
| 2024 | £579,959 | £582,008 | £580,721 | £181,760 | £173,498 | 29 / 3 |
| 2023 | £538,568 | £565,873 | £565,873 | £184,043 | £139,612 | 29 / 3 |
| 2022 | £519,959 | £540,547 | £538,644 | £213,114 | £139,946 | 27 / 1 |
| 2021 | £559,343 | £511,671 | £511,605 | £231,702 | £100,000 | 27 / 0 |
Staff column shows: Employees / Volunteers
